A freelance artist has added more weight to the rumour that an HD Mortal Kombat "Kollection" is on its way to PS3.

That artist goes by the name of Patrick Delmastro, and his portfolio cites past work (from March 2009 onwards) on projects including one Mortal Kombat HD Arcade Kollection (via Mortal Kombat Online). UPDATE: This has since been removed.

His word by itself won't sink ships, but then he isn't alone: GAME still carries a listing for Mortal Kombat HD Arcade Kollection from all the way back in September 2010. If it's wrong, why hasn't it been removed?

GameStop also briefly listed the Kollection.

That Kollection is rumoured to house Mortal Kombat, Mortal Kombat II and Ultimate Mortal Kombat 3 all under one roof - plus a demo for Warner's new Mortal Kombat game.

It's similar to what Sony has already done with the God of War Collection and the Sly Trilogy, and what will be done with the Tomb Raider Trilogy, which is also a PS3 exclusive.
